PFAS investigation needs a source-led strategy and suitable analytical sensitivity

Environmental field sampling supporting a targeted PFAS assessment.
Environmental sampling supporting a targeted understanding of PFAS sources and pathways.
What a robust scope should cover
  • Potential PFAS source inventory based on site history and activities
  • Groundwater, surface-water and other sensitive receptor pathways
  • Sampling locations, media and contamination-control procedures
  • Analytical suite and reporting limits appropriate to the project objective
  • Interpretation of detections in the context of source, pathway and receptor
  • Recommendations for delineation, water assessment, management or further investigation
What the work should leave you with
  • A clearer view of whether PFAS is a credible site-specific issue
  • Data collected through a sampling strategy designed to minimise cross-contamination
  • Interpretation linked to the relevant environmental pathway
  • Proportionate next steps rather than isolated laboratory results
Why the detail mattersPFAS results can be difficult to interpret without source and pathway context. The investigation strategy should be designed before sampling so the data answers a defined question.

Useful to know before you enquire

Tell us why PFAS is suspectedFormer fire-training areas, foam use, certain industrial activities and other site history can help focus the source review.
Water pathways are often importantGroundwater and surface water can be key receptors and migration pathways, so hydrogeological context matters.
Sampling needs contamination controlPFAS can be present in common materials and equipment, so field procedures should minimise the risk of introducing contamination during sampling.
Existing laboratory data may still be usefulSend previous results with the method and reporting limits so we can assess whether they are suitable for the project question.
FAQ

Common questions

What site history can indicate potential PFAS risk?

Potential sources can include historic use of certain fire-fighting foams and some industrial processes, but the relevance depends on the specific site history and pathways.

Can PFAS be assessed in groundwater?

Yes. Groundwater can be an important migration pathway and receptor, and may form part of a targeted investigation where the Conceptual Site Model supports it.

Why are PFAS sampling procedures different?

Because PFAS can be present in a wide range of products and materials, sampling plans often include additional contamination-control measures to reduce the risk of false or misleading results.
